[edit] Biography
Mike Brumley (Tony Mike Brumley) was born on July 10, 1938 in Granite, Oklahoma. He made his Major League debut on April 18, 1964 for the Washington Senators. In 1964, his rookie year, he hit .244 with 2 home runs and 35 RBI. Brumley played for the Washington Senators for his entire 3 year career.

[edit] Transactions
- Signed as an amateur free agent by Brooklyn Dodgers (1957).
- Sold by Los Angeles Dodgers to Washington Senators (October 14, 1963).
